A recently launched app uses artificial intelligence and educational games to inspire children to exercise.
Lucas and his friends is designed for ages 4-8 and offers an interactive learning experience in which players play games by moving to select the correct answers.
Using basic moves and following simple instructions, players can stretch or jump in order to ‘touch’ or ‘catch’ the correct answers, helping them develop strength, endurance, coordination and flexibility while by practicing English and science, technology, engineering and math (STEM) skills.
“At a time when kids are spending more and more time in front of their screens, we’ve created a way to make that time more educational and active,” said Wayne Chung, CEO and Co-Founder of GOFA INTERNATIONAL, creator of Luca & Friends.
“This app includes English basics such as nouns and grammar, as well as STEM content such as insect, vegetable and fruit knowledge and skip counting, and provides children with fun, exciting and designed to help instill healthy habits.Through the use of AI technology, these games encourage movement and learning, giving children the perfect platform to improve their knowledge and increase their daily exercise .
The story of Luca & Friends centers on a galaxy far, far away, where Prince Luca and his alien friends Pumkey, Digby and Mighty Coke embark on a mission to save Earth from hate, fighting and hurt. The characters then appear in the app to connect children to exciting worlds of learning and movement.
Key features of Luca & Friends will include the following:
- Social Interaction: All games are socially interactive with a leaderboard and other social elements.
- Educational content: Luca & Friends offers over 100 lessons and activities covering English and STEM subjects. All content has been created by accredited teachers and trainers and is tied to program standards.
- Rewards: Luca & Friends offers loyalty and rewards programs to motivate kids to stay active.
- Parent Dashboard: The progress dashboard in the parent area shows parents their child’s play history and allows them to track their child’s growth status.
- Playback Mode: The app collects a short video of the player so they can see themselves moving during gameplay.
- Silent Mode: Players can return to touchscreen gaming in situations where there is no ability to move.
- Multiple Display Options: While the app is recommended for iPad and tablet use, gamers can also connect their device to a large-format smart TV via AirPlay or Chromecast and play in front of a larger screen.
